Summary
Localized fat deposits in obese individuals can mimic mediastinal tumors on chest X-rays. Recognizing this can prevent unnecessary surgery and guide appropriate patient management.

Main Results:
- Localized deposits of normal adipose tissue can present as masses in the mediastinum on chest X-rays.
- These fat deposits share imaging characteristics with certain mediastinal tumors, posing a diagnostic challenge.
- Distinguishing benign fat from malignant or other neoplastic masses is critical.
Conclusions:
- Obesity-related localized fat deposits are a crucial consideration in the differential diagnosis of mediastinal masses.
- Radiographic interpretation should carefully evaluate for signs suggestive of benign fat infiltration.
- Appropriate recognition can prevent invasive procedures and guide conservative management strategies.
